Evaluate the Scope of Work


The cost depends on various factors, such as size of the lot, vegetation type, and the amount of removable debris. Therefore, it's important to evaluate the scope of work before hiring. If you have a small lot with minimal vegetation, the cost will be lower than a larger one with dense vegetation.


Consider Partial Clearing


If you're on a low budget, try partial lot clearing rather than full clearing. This means to get rid of only the required vegetation and debris to make the desired space, rather than completely clearing the entire lot. Partial clearing seems to be cost-effective, especially if there are areas that don't require clearing.


Dispose of Debris Wisely


Some lot clearing services offer debris removal in their quote, while others charge an additional fee. To save, you can consider dispose the debris yourself if permitted by local regulations. Composting, chipping, or mulching can be environment-friendly and cost-effective for debris handling. Get a Detailed Contract


Before hiring, make sure to retrieve a detailed contract with scope of work, costs, and timelines. Read the contract carefully and ensure all the services and costs are stated clearly. Avoid any verbal agreements and insist on a written contract to be on a safer side from any disputes or hidden costs later on.


Maintenance and Prevention


After the Labelle land clearing is complete, it's important to properly maintain the cleared area to prevent future overgrowth and the need for costly clearing in the future. Regularly mow the grass, trim trees and bushes, and keep the area free from debris. By maintaining the cleared lot, you can prevent vegetation from overgrowing and lower the need for expensive land clearing in the long run.
